I am 10 th grader ( 2022 - 2023 ) preparing for iit jee by self study and yt lectures. Actually I had a doubt that when I go in class 11th should I join online or offline ( it takes almost 50 minutes from my home to reach the institute)?

If you are really willing to join an institution, join it OFFLINE, because offline institutes will be providing more detailed lectures, more study material and frequent tests also (which is most important)

Cons of ONLINE :
- Toooo much distraction
- No personal guidance
- Lack of Advanced level concept understanding
- Lack of practice papers
- You will not get aura of studying like offline
- Much lesser competition
.... And many more

So as per person experience, I'd suggest OFFLINE INSTITUTES
